How much do project coordinator oem j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 9, 2026, the average hourly pay for project coordinator oem in the United States is $28.81,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$22.36 and $33.17 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Job description

Project Coordinator Position Overview

We are hiring a Quality Containment Project Coordinator to support quality, containment, and mechanical rework projects in a fast-paced manufacturing environment.

This is a hands-on coordination role for someone with quality, containment, mechanical rework, or manufacturing experience who can help oversee daily operations, maintain quality standards, coordinate small teams, and support new project launches.

The ideal candidate is mechanically inclined, highly organized, comfortable working on the manufacturing floor, and able to communicate effectively with customers, supervisors, inspectors, and production teams.

Key Responsibilities
  • Coordinate and oversee daily quality containment and inspection activities
  • Support mechanical rework operations and ensure work is completed according to specifications
  • Provide direction and support to small teams to keep projects on schedule
  • Communicate with customers, supervisors, inspectors, and production personnel to maintain workflow
  • Identify quality issues and help troubleshoot and resolve problems
  • Perform detailed dimensional inspections using precision measuring equipment
  • Accurately document inspection results, project activity, and quality records
  • Maintain accurate and timely reports and project documentation
  • Assist with new site and project launches, including setup, training, and process validation
  • Monitor project progress and help ensure customer and quality requirements are met
  • Support process improvements and identify opportunities to improve quality and efficiency
  • Maintain a safe, organized, and productive work environment
  • Work overtime, weekends, and varying hours based on production and project needs
  • Travel to other sites or project locations as needed
Required Qualifications
  • 2+ years of experience in quality, containment, or quality supervision/leadership
  • Mechanical rework or manufacturing experience required
  • Experience coordinating quality or containment activities
  • Experience working with small teams in a manufacturing or production environment
  • Strong mechanical aptitude
  • Experience performing dimensional inspections
  • Ability to use precision measuring tools such as:
    • Calipers
    • Pin gauges
    • Micrometers
    • Height gauges
  • Strong problem-solving and decision-making skills
  • Excellent organizational and communication skills
  • Ability to read and follow technical specifications and work instructions
  • Ability to work independently while coordinating with customers and internal teams
  • Must be flexible to work overtime, weekends, and varying schedules as needed
Preferred Qualifications
  • Engineering or technical education
  • Quality containment experience
  • Automotive manufacturing experience
  • Experience with mechanical rework
  • Previous quality lead, quality supervisor, or team lead experience
  • Experience supporting new site or project launches
  • Experience working with OEM or automotive manufacturing customers
